In Dec. I got c diff after a round of antibiotics. Gastric Dr put me on Vancomycin but the symptoms came back in Jan. (Not as severe). I read about the benefits of Probiotics for c diff so I started taking them (Natures Bounty Probiotic 10, has 20 billion live cultures) in Jan. The problem is There are so many products out there and I wanted to know if there is a specific brand that helps with this illness. Some days I feel OK but others I have bloating, and lower abdominal pain. The diarrhea has abated.

@carolm13 - I tried Align for a few months, but it was not very effective. My pharmacist suggested one with 30billion or more active cells and more strains so I switched to Costco’s Health Balance (made in Canada - where I live). It might be sold under another name at the US Costco. I have been on this for three months and it is working better for me than Align. Probiotics are all trial and error, and it seems what works for one doesn’t for another.

Whichever brand you choose to take, try something with 30 billion or more active cells, and more than eight or ten strains. Mine has eight.

I had C-diff in 2011 from 10 days of Amoxicillin given to me by my dentist. I was in the hospital for a week. Besides fluids and antibiotics, the hospital also gave me Florastor probiotic. I have continued to take it whenever I have a hint of diarrhea. I would expect that you could ask a Gastroenterologist about what would be the best probiotic product for you to take.
When I left the hospital, they prescribed me 10 days of Vancomycin. Fortunately, I have not had any reoccurrences and it is 11 years now. I bleached my home when I got home from the hospital to kill any spores of C-diff I might have left.
I have not used oral antibiotics since my episode. Has anyone used general oral antibiotics since having C-diff? Are there any studies? I am wondering what happens if one really needs to take them
